In a startling development, residents in the northwestern Iranian border city of Jolfa reported observing multiple drone sightings on Tuesday. Eyewitnesses claimed that a total of 6 drones were spotted moving towards the eastern and central regions of Iran, with each aircraft appearing at two-minute intervals.
According to social media posts from @FotrosResistance, a social media channel known for releasing information related to Iranian security matters, the drone sightings took place near the city of Jolfa, which shares a border with Azerbaijan.
